About Dongdong Zhan

Dongdong Zhan is a scholar working on Toxicology, Spectroscopy and Oncology, having authored 16 papers that have together received 146 indexed citations. Recurring topics across this work include Advanced Proteomics Techniques and Applications (4 papers), RNA modifications and cancer (4 papers) and DNA Repair Mechanisms (2 papers). The work is most often cited by research in Cancer Research (32 citations), Spectroscopy (23 citations) and Reproductive Medicine (11 citations). Dongdong Zhan has collaborated with scholars based in China and United States. Frequent co-authors include Jun Qin, Lei Song, Chunchao Zhang, Jine Li, Chen Ding, Mingwei Liu, Tongqing Gong, Xia Xia, Xiaotian Ni and Bei Zhen. Their work appears in journals such as Nature Communications, Genome Research and British Journal of Cancer.
